Norman Hepple, RA, RP

1908-1994

Self Portrait

Ref: 1856

Oil on board, 31 by 20 cm

Provenance: Prosper Devas (godson of the artist); thence by descent

 

A printed note by Prosper Devas attached to the back of this painting sheds light on the artist’s ingenious use of paint: “self-portrait by Norman Hepple, my godfather. Painted using only Burnt Sienna and Ivory Black.” Prosper Devas was the son of the painter Anthony Devas who was a close friend of Hepple.
